"You know, people come up with formulas who are uncreative. They can't picture something different so they can only go by something that's laid out for them"
About this Quote
The intent is defensive and declarative at once. For performers and creators, “formula” often shows up as a note from a producer, a workshop rule, a market-tested beat sheet: do it like the last hit, land the joke here, soften the edge there. Bologna frames that impulse as a failure of visualization. If you can’t picture something different, you outsource your taste to whatever’s already been approved. That’s the subtext: formula isn’t just a tool, it’s a permission slip for the anxious.
Context matters because Bologna came up in an entertainment economy that increasingly rewarded repeatable products: sitcom rhythms, star personas, genre lanes. In that world, formulas aren’t invented by nobodies; they’re enforced by institutions. But his provocation works because he personalizes the blame. “Uncreative” stings. It draws a hard line between making and managing, between the artist’s messy leaps and the bureaucrat’s safe bets.
The irony is that every great comic and actor relies on craft - timing, structure, repetition. Bologna’s point isn’t “never use a formula.” It’s that when the formula becomes the imagination, the work turns into compliance. The line reads like a warning: if you can’t see beyond the map, you’ll confuse the map for the territory.
